South Foreland Lighthouse, the first in the world to be electrically powered in 1859. It was also the site of the first ship to shore radio transmission and the first international radio transmission (from Wimereux in France)when Guglielmo Marconi conducted experiments here in 1899. This lighthouse is now owned by the National Trust and is opened to the public.
